gpt4 book ai didi

java - 仅在 Maven Deploy 中编译新更改的文件

转载 作者:行者123 更新时间:2023-11-30 11:41:13 24 4
gpt4 key购买 nike

我们将 Maven 用于我们的 Web 应用程序,并且我们曾经使用 Ant。

在 ANT 中部署时,您可以将其设置为不使用 war 文件,只将新文件复制到部署文件夹中。在本地计算机上工作时,这可以极大地节省时间。

在 Maven 中,我希望它以同样的方式工作。无论主项目或其依赖项之一是否有更改,我都希望它只重新编译并复制新更改的文件。有办法做到这一点吗?

最佳答案

如果您通过将文件从您的项目目录复制到例如 Tomcat webapps 目录来“部署”- 通过 maven-antrun-plugin 在 Maven 中执行相同的操作.

否则,我建议使用 cargo-maven2-plugintomcat7-maven-plugin .

关于java - 仅在 Maven Deploy 中编译新更改的文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12357326/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com